Skip to content

Commit

Permalink
Merge pull request #272 from NiloCK/addnote-api-tests
Browse files Browse the repository at this point in the history
more dynamic imports for markdown renderer...
  • Loading branch information
NiloCK authored Sep 15, 2023
2 parents 66bdd7a + 0504a3c commit f9edef8
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 6 deletions.
Original file line number Diff line number Diff line change
@@ -1,17 +1,16 @@
<template>
<v-card v-bind:class="`${className}`" v-on:mouseover="select" v-on:click="submitThisOption">
<mdr v-bind:md="content" />
<markdown-renderer v-bind:md="content" />
</v-card>
</template>

<script lang="ts">
import MarkdownRenderer from '@/base-course/Components/MarkdownRenderer.vue';
import Vue from 'vue';
import { Component, Prop } from 'vue-property-decorator';
@Component({
components: {
"mdr": MarkdownRenderer,
MarkdownRenderer: () => import('@/base-course/Components/MarkdownRenderer.vue'),
},
})
export default class MultipleChoiceOption extends Vue {
Expand Down
5 changes: 2 additions & 3 deletions packages/vue/src/courses/default/questions/fillIn/fillIn.vue
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
<template>
<div>
<audio-auto-player v-if="hasAudio" v-bind:src="audioURL" />
<mdr v-bind:md="question.mdText" />
<markdown-renderer v-bind:md="question.mdText" />
<radio-multiple-choice v-if="question.options" v-bind:choiceList="truncatedOptions" v-bind:MouseTrap="MouseTrap" />
<center v-else-if="priorAttempts == 1" class="title">
<span>
Expand All @@ -22,7 +22,6 @@

<script lang="ts">
import AudioAutoPlayer from '@/base-course/Components/AudioAutoPlayer.vue';
import MarkdownRenderer from '@/base-course/Components/MarkdownRenderer.vue';
import RadioMultipleChoice from '@/base-course/Components/RadioMultipleChoice.vue';
import { QuestionView } from '@/base-course/Viewable';
import _ from 'lodash';
Expand All @@ -40,7 +39,7 @@ const typeMap: {
@Component({
components: {
"MarkdownRenderer": () => import('@/base-course/Components/MarkdownRenderer.vue'), // fix against "unknown custom element" bug (?).
MarkdownRenderer: () => import('@/base-course/Components/MarkdownRenderer.vue'), // fix against "unknown custom element" bug (?).
RadioMultipleChoice,
blankType: FillInInput,
textType: FillInText,
Expand Down

0 comments on commit f9edef8

Please sign in to comment.